Currently, we are looking to hire a Property Manager for one of our portfolios. As a Property Manager, you will be reporting to the Senior Property Manager overseeing your portfolio.
The responsibilities for this job include, but are not limited to, the following:
- Attend regular board meetings.
- Prepare and present Management Reports
- Make sure minutes are completed and delivered.
- Obtain, review, deliver and present financial statements.
- Frequently speak to unit occupants to get general opinions on trade work completed, service being provided and general condition of the site.
- Use direct communication with residents such as letters & newsletters to transmit value being delivered.
- Research relevant documentation and advise residents regarding same.
- Perform regular inspections and arrange for repairs and/or quotes.
- Process invoices.
- Set Annual General Meeting date in conjunction with the Board and notify head office as soon as possible with details.
- Ensure that the proper insurance coverage is maintained for the corporation.
- Manage all on-site staff.
- Ensure that reporting staff has someone to fill in,
in the event of their absence.
- Manage all trades.
- Inspect complete property at least once per month for deficiencies.
- Analyze the property operation to ensure that the management contract is being carried out.
- Ensure that all internal policies and procedures are followed properly and entirely.
- The Property Manager is ultimately responsible to ensure that the Corporation property is maintained properly.
